Note that power consumption of some processors can well exceed their nominal TDP, even without overclocking. Some can even double their declared thermals given that the motherboard allows to tune the CPU power parameters.

Passmark

Passmark CPU Mark is a widespread benchmark, consisting of 8 different types of workload, including integer and floating point math, extended instructions, compression, encryption and physics calculation. There is also one separate single-threaded scenario measuring single-core performance.

Celeron N3450 1986
+79.2%
Celeron 1005M 1108

Celeron N3450 has a 80.6% higher aggregate performance score, an age advantage of 3 years, 100% more physical cores and 100% more threads, a 57.1% more advanced lithography process, and 483.3% lower power consumption.

The Celeron N3450 is our recommended choice as it beats the Celeron 1005M in performance tests.
